diff options
author | Samuli Suominen <ssuominen@gentoo.org> | 2012-12-11 16:22:32 +0000 |
---|---|---|
committer | Samuli Suominen <ssuominen@gentoo.org> | 2012-12-11 16:22:32 +0000 |
commit | b919e3b014e2ece20418ec66253097344940e1f2 (patch) | |
tree | 6e70b5f1a3dd8b5fd29cebac0032f7eb520f458f /sys-apps | |
parent | old (diff) | |
download | gentoo-2-b919e3b014e2ece20418ec66253097344940e1f2.tar.gz gentoo-2-b919e3b014e2ece20418ec66253097344940e1f2.tar.bz2 gentoo-2-b919e3b014e2ece20418ec66253097344940e1f2.zip |
Port to udev.eclass.
(Portage version: 2.2.0_alpha147/cvs/Linux x86_64, signed Manifest commit with key 4868F14D)
Diffstat (limited to 'sys-apps')
-rw-r--r-- | sys-apps/lomoco/ChangeLog | 5 | ||||
-rw-r--r-- | sys-apps/lomoco/lomoco-1.0-r9.ebuild | 22 |
2 files changed, 12 insertions, 15 deletions
diff --git a/sys-apps/lomoco/ChangeLog b/sys-apps/lomoco/ChangeLog index 98f03edf8ce2..2f43d04d5ce0 100644 --- a/sys-apps/lomoco/ChangeLog +++ b/sys-apps/lomoco/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for sys-apps/lomoco #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/lomoco/ChangeLog,v 1.23 2012/12/11 16:19:36 ssuominen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/lomoco/ChangeLog,v 1.24 2012/12/11 16:22:32 ssuominen Exp $ + + 11 Dec 2012; Samuli Suominen <ssuominen@gentoo.org> lomoco-1.0-r9.ebuild: + Port to udev.eclass. 11 Dec 2012; Samuli Suominen <ssuominen@gentoo.org> -lomoco-1.0-r7.ebuild, -lomoco-1.0-r8.ebuild: diff --git a/sys-apps/lomoco/lomoco-1.0-r9.ebuild b/sys-apps/lomoco/lomoco-1.0-r9.ebuild index 60dae0c5037d..3265ff13723b 100644 --- a/sys-apps/lomoco/lomoco-1.0-r9.ebuild +++ b/sys-apps/lomoco/lomoco-1.0-r9.ebuild @@ -1,9 +1,9 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/lomoco/lomoco-1.0-r9.ebuild,v 1.3 2012/11/21 10:10:57 ago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/lomoco/lomoco-1.0-r9.ebuild,v 1.4 2012/12/11 16:22:31 ssuominen Exp $ EAPI=4 -inherit autotools eutils multilib toolchain-funcs +inherit autotools eutils multilib toolchain-funcs udev DESCRIPTION="Lomoco can configure vendor-specific options on Logitech USB mice." HOMEPAGE="http://www.lomoco.org/" @@ -14,8 +14,7 @@ SLOT="0" KEYWORDS="~alpha amd64 x86" IUSE="" -RDEPEND="!<sys-fs/udev-114 - virtual/libusb:0" +RDEPEND="virtual/libusb:0" DEPEND="${RDEPEND} virtual/pkgconfig" @@ -23,14 +22,12 @@ DOCS="AUTHORS ChangeLog NEWS README" src_prepare() { cp -f "${FILESDIR}"/lomoco-pm-utils-r1 "${T}" || die - local udevdir=/lib/udev - has_version sys-fs/udev && udevdir="$($(tc-getPKG_CONFIG) --variable=udevdir udev)" - sed -i -e "s|@UDEVDIR@|${udevdir}|" "${T}"/lomoco-pm-utils-r1 || die + sed -i -e "s|@UDEVDIR@|$(udev_get_udevdir)|" "${T}"/lomoco-pm-utils-r1 || die epatch \ "${FILESDIR}"/${P}-gentoo-hardware-support.patch \ - "${FILESDIR}"/${P}-updated-udev.patch \ - + "${FILESDIR}"/${P}-updated-udev.patch + eautoreconf } @@ -42,13 +39,10 @@ src_compile() { src_install() { default - local udevdir=/lib/udev - has_version sys-fs/udev && udevdir="$($(tc-getPKG_CONFIG) --variable=udevdir udev)" - - insinto "${udevdir}"/rules.d + insinto "$(udev_get_udevdir)"/rules.d newins udev/lomoco.rules 40-lomoco.rules - exeinto "${udevdir}" + exeinto "$(udev_get_udevdir)" newexe udev/udev.lomoco lomoco insinto /etc |